Accident Short Stirling Mk IV LJ943,

Date:Thursday 21 September 1944
Time:16:45 LT

Short Stirling Mk IV
Owner/operator:190 Sqn RAF
Registration: LJ943
MSN: G5-
Fatalities:Fatalities: 7 / Occupants: 9
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:near 'De Slop' farm, Zetten, Gelderland -   Netherlands
Phase: Combat
Nature:Military
Departure airport:RAF Fairford, Gloucestershire
Destination airport:
Narrative:
Takeoff at 13:43 hrs for a re-supply operation in support of Market Garden.
Crashed due to combat.

Crew:
Pilot P/O. R.B. Herger J/89135 RCAF Oosterbeek War Cemetery; 4 D 6-7
Flight Engineer Sgt. L. Hillyard 1818509 RAF Survived - injured, POW
Navigator F/O. O.H. Antoft J/25114 RCAF Oosterbeek War Cemetery; 4 D 6-7 - from Denmark
Bomb Aimer F/O. J.K. MacDonnell J/28491 RCAF Oosterbeek War Cemetery; 4 D 8
Wireless Operator/Air Gunner W/O II L.I. Whitlock R/155222 RCAF Oosterbeek War Cemetery; 4 D 6-7
Air Gunner F/O. H.A. Thornington 143115 RAF Oosterbeek War Cemetery; 4 D 11
Air Gunner W/O J. Thomas R/173863 RCAF Survived - injured, POW
Air Despatcher Drv. E. Noble T157697 RASC Oosterbeek War Cemetery; 18 B 9-10
Air Despatcher Drv. C. Parker T175876 RASC Oosterbeek War Cemetery; 18 B 9-10
